Quit bashing LeBron. He said from the very begining that its all about winning multiple championships. His very best shot at that is with his 2 best friends in Miami. Sure, I feel bad for Cleveland. But he gave them all he had for 7 years and it just wasn't enough thru no fault of his own. He wanted to play with the best players possible and did exactly that. To say he's selfish is crazy talk. He is taking less to play in Miami. He is going to be sharing the spot light with another top 3 player in the league. How exactly is that selfish. And speaking of not selfish, Dwade has gotten be given the Unselfishness Award of the decade for opening his arms and inviting those two players to Miami. Refreshing to see now-a-days.
You need top quality teammates to win multiple titles and become a dynasty. MJ played with Pippen, who was arguably a top 3 player in his prime. Bird played with two hall of fame big men in Parish and McHale. Magic with Kareem and Worthy all three hall of famers. Duncan won with future hall of famer David Robinson, not to mention Parker/Manu. And Kobe won with Shaq. Its not cowardly that he wanted to join up with the best teammates available. It just makes sense. The man wants to win and win a lot.
I have to admit the one-hour special is pretty narsisistic, but all proceeds went to the Boys and Girls Club. Plus how could you not be full of yourself when you're a world famous millionaire at 25. If I were him I'd probably be 10x worse than Kenny Powers

And anyone who thinks the NBA is boring, has obviously not watched a game in the last 10 years. The talent level is beyond anything we've ever seen. And this attitude of winning championships and team first is amazing.

Here is my opinion, and some facts.

Lebron, Wade and Bosh all were drafted the same year (2003) and at that time all talked to each other and made sure they would all be free agents at the same time. They did that.

All 3 have been friends and talking about the possibility and wanting to play with each other even further back than they're closer conversations during their gold medal run in the Beijing Olympics.

All 3 talked and had conferences after Lebron and the Cavs lost in the NBA Playoffs.

Do I think this was merely a "last minute decision" and he had really considered playing for all the teams that "courted" him. I don't think so.

Here is a statement from the "show":
"I can't say it was always in my plans, because I never thought it was possible," James said on a made-for-LeBron live show on ESPN.
That may be true...but then he goes on....
"But the things that the Miami Heat franchise have done, to free up cap space and be able to put themselves in a position this summer to have all three of us, it was hard to turn down. Those are two great players, two of the greatest players that we have in this game today."
Notice the bold faced words.

So what do I take from this.....the Cavaliers, Knicks, Bulls, Clippers and Nets should NOT have been lobbying Lebron James...they in reality SHOULD have been trying to get Wade and Bosh. That seems to be the reason James went to Miami. Do I think Miami had the inside track....of course. Pat Riley knew from Wade that he could have all 3 most likely last year...thus Riley making sure they had the money for all 3.

If that was the real reason...to play with both his buddies....why not start out by saying that. Tell all the teams trying to land him, "If you get Bosh and Wade, Ill come next" and those teams could have had a real shot.

This whole thing stinks the way it played out. Once Wade and Bosh agreed on Wed. AM, I knew he was Miami bound.

I'm not a big basketball fan, but I did like James. Now...not so much. The way (in my opinion) he used and abused his status and again...I think this move had been planned a long time ago. His preference was to play with these 2, tell the other teams, make it fair.

I don't know what will happen from here, but I wish the Cavs and their fans luck. They are going to need it...but I will be rooting for them.
